[House Number.01], a collectible leather goods and accessories house founded by Marcela Vélez, takes its name from the original house moniker conceived by Swiss artist Ugo Rondinone in 2014, in the woods of a small village on the outskirts of Zurich.

More than a house, it is a fusion of architecture, sculpture, and stage set, a place designed equally for living and creating, a prism of ephemeral reflections and divine proportions.

Much of the design philosophy behind House Number.01 draws from the sacred geometry present in the groundbreaking work of Emma Kunz and Hilma af Klint. Their essence and vision serve as a central source of inspiration for the design of these sculptural pieces.

The Golden Spiral, understood as an expression of divinity unfolded and decoded through the mathematical formula of the Fibonacci Sequence, is seen as a mysterious equation of the Cosmos and the principal foundation of House Number.01's ethos.
